• BTC Dominance: %
XBT.Market
Advertisement
  • Home
  • Coins MarketCap
  • Crypto Exchanges
  • Crypto Calculator
  • Top Gainers and Loser
  • News
  • Contact Us
No Result
View All Result
XBT.Market
No Result
View All Result
Home Bitcoin

Solana and Ethereum smart contract audits, explained

Jon Hartney by Jon Hartney
July 21, 2022
in Bitcoin, Blockchain, Business, Market
0
189
SHARES
1.5k
VIEWS
Share on FacebookShare on Twitter

What are smart contract audits, how do they work, and how do they benefit the crypto projects who get their code scrutinized? Let’s find out.

Related articles

Bitcoin derivatives data shows room for BTC price to move higher this week

January 23, 2023

Bitcoin price consolidation opens the door for APE, MANA, AAVE and FIL to move higher

January 22, 2023

Do smart contract audits improve crypto’s image?

Blockchain technology is becoming a bigger part of all our lives — and auditors like Hacken are ensuring that crypto projects put their best foot forward.

Improving the quality of smart contracts helps reduce those unpleasant headlines about major hacks in the press, and boosts the reputation of crypto projects in the public’s eyes.

Once an investigation has taken place, Hacken offers labels to ensure verified projects can declare they’re audited by Hacken on an official website. 

Reports are also attached to a crypto project’s official presence on major websites such as CoinMarketCap and CoinGecko. 

The most common types of contracts that the company interacts with include token, token sale, exchange, ERC-721, swap farming, staking, ERC-20, BEP-20 and reward pool. 

Already a member of the Enterprise Ethereum Alliance and Solana Foundation, Hacken has its sights set on winning a 20% share of the Web3 cybersecurity market by 2024.

Learn more about Hacken

Disclaimer. Cointelegraph does not endorse any content or product on this page. While we aim at providing you with all important information that we could obtain, readers should do their own research before taking any actions related to the company and carry full responsibility for their decisions, nor can this article be considered as investment advice.

And how long do smart contract audits take?

It’s a process that takes several weeks — depending on how quickly a crypto project works.

Hacken says initial audits typically take 2 to 14 days depending on a smart contract’s complexity and size… and if it’s urgent, these investigations can be expedited. Again, for larger protocols, it might take longer — 30 days in some cases.

At this point, a project will be given recommendations on what needs to be fixed — and how quickly these changes are made will depend on them. Auditors like Hacken then offer a remediation check to ensure all of the vulnerabilities have been patched over to a high standard.

How much do smart contract audits cost?

As you might expect, this depends on how complex a smart contract is.

According to Hacken, this can extend to $500,000 for larger projects where there are more lines of code — not least because of the additional engineering hours it’ll take.

The company argues these costs pale into comparison with the economic damage that a smart contract vulnerability can bring.

Hacken cites data showing that, in 2021, 80% of the incidents affecting decentralized applications related to smart contracts — with losses hitting $6.9 billion.

Breaking this down even further, and we can see that the average cost per project stands at $47 million. Somehow, $500,000 looks a lot less expensive now. 

Overall, 60% of its clients have been based on Ethereum so far in 2022.

And here’s the difference it can make — after an audit, at least one critical bug was uncovered in 80% of projects. But Hacken says just 75% have fully acted on an audit report in the past — with the remainder ignoring the conclusions, or only taking a small number of recommendations into account. As a result, they had a lower security score.

How do smart contract audits benefit crypto projects?

Audits are vital for ironing out any kinks in a crypto project, and ensuring code is ready to be used by the masses.

Hackers were responsible for stealing $1.3 billion in 78 incidents across the first quarter of 2022 alone, and two-thirds of these attacks were on the Ethereum and Solana blockchains.

But what causes certain projects to be targeted… and how could a smart contract audit have helped them? 

Well, common reasons include crypto projects prioritizing speed — and failing to factor in time for a comprehensive audit from a dependable provider. 

They may also rely on their own in-house teams to perform security checks. And although this looks financially sensible, there’s a danger that internal staff may not be up to date on the latest hacking techniques used by malicious actors.

Inevitably, some will also believe that they are too good to fail. But complacency is enemy number one in the crypto space, and even the finest projects can fall victim to a hack.

Are Solana smart contract audits different?

Smart contract audits will vary slightly depending on the blockchain code is based on.

Common security vulnerabilities on Solana can include missed ownership checks, meaning attackers can use fake configurations to bypass access controls.

And while smart contracts can call functions from external smart contracts, validation failures could mean black hat hackers get an opportunity to supply malicious inputs that affect how the code operates.

Top auditing firms will access a Solana smart contract based on documentation quality, security, architecture quality and code quality. Vulnerabilities are assigned a severity level too, meaning business-critical issues can be tackled first.

How does an Ethereum smart contract audit work?

The best security firms will put code through stress tests to see how they perform in a range of scenarios.

Experts say it’s important for a project to provide a complete and clear technical specification — and ideally, offer documentation of the deployment process.

These audits aren’t just about uncovering issues that black hat hackers could take advantage of, but flaws that could stop an Ethereum smart contract from working correctly.

The attack vectors being scrutinized can get rather technical — but they include replay attacks, where valid data transmissions are repeatedly made by malicious actors in order to execute fraudulent activities. Others include reentrancy attacks, reordering attacks and short address attacks.

Once an investigation has been completed, crypto projects receive a detailed report of the vulnerabilities within their code — alongside recommendations on how to mitigate their impact, or eliminate them altogether. 

As a result, the resources saved through an effective audit can far outweigh the cost… and it can avoid reputational damage, too.

What is a smart contract audit?

Smart contract audits involve scrutinizing the code of crypto projects — highlighting security vulnerabilities.

Smart contracts are a crucial cog of the crypto ecosystem — and they’ve unlocked a plethora of use cases for blockchain technology.

But for developers who are furiously writing code, safety needs to be a number one priority. Smart contract exploits can put user funds at risk, and we’ve all seen headlines of high-profile hacks where eye-watering sums of money were lost.

An audit allows an independent organization to kick the tires of a smart contract, and detect vulnerabilities before they’re spotted by malicious actors. This can help crypto projects to achieve credibility, all while giving users peace of mind. Audits are typically done before smart contracts are deployed, as they can be difficult to fix once uploaded to a network.

Smart contracts are commonly found on blockchains including Ethereum and Solana.

Read Entire Article
Tags: CointelegraphCryptocurrencyInvestmentMining Bitcoin
Share76Tweet47

Related Posts

Bitcoin derivatives data shows room for BTC price to move higher this week

by Jon Hartney
January 23, 2023
0

BTC options data suggest that the Bitcoin price rally still has legs, even with wider economic concerns growing and the

Bitcoin price consolidation opens the door for APE, MANA, AAVE and FIL to move higher

by Jon Hartney
January 22, 2023
0

BTC could take a break from its sharp rally and if BTC price bounces off underlying support, APE, MANA, AAVE...

Genesis bankruptcy case scheduled for first hearing

by Jon Hartney
January 22, 2023
0

The first hearing in Genesis Capital's bankruptcy case will be held on January 23, according to court filings

Terra lending protocol Mars to launch mainnet

by Jon Hartney
January 22, 2023
0

The Mars Hub will launch an independent Cosmos application chain and issue MARS to users who hold the token during...

Central African Republic eyes legal framework for crypto adoption

by Jon Hartney
January 22, 2023
0

A 15-member committee is tasked with working on a legal framework that will allow cryptocurrencies to operate in

Load More
  • Trending
  • Comments
  • Latest

Ethereum Classic gets ‘endorsement’ from Vitalik Buterin, but ETC price still risks 50% crash

July 27, 2022

Critique on Helium’s $6.5K monthly revenue causes a stir

July 28, 2022

All aboard! Elon Musk’s Vegas Loop now taking Dogecoin payments

July 7, 2022

Cardano Vasil hard fork hit with another delay for several weeks

July 29, 2022

All aboard! Elon Musk’s Vegas Loop now taking Dogecoin payments

0

Crypto owners banned from working on US Government crypto policies

0

Korean startup Uprise lost $20M shorting LUNC

0

Ethereum testnet Merge mostly successful — ‘Hiccups will not delay the Merge.’

0

Bitcoin derivatives data shows room for BTC price to move higher this week

January 23, 2023

Bitcoin price consolidation opens the door for APE, MANA, AAVE and FIL to move higher

January 22, 2023

Genesis bankruptcy case scheduled for first hearing

January 22, 2023

Terra lending protocol Mars to launch mainnet

January 22, 2023

XBT.Market

This website is an automated news feed powered by the Nebulome cloud system. The site is made possible by YYC TECH Consulting and Alberta Digital Mining Company. As a team with major crypto and bitcoin enthusiasm, we have curated major sources of news, trading and financial data to bring you, our viewer, an unbiased source of truth.

Recent Posts

  • Bitcoin derivatives data shows room for BTC price to move higher this week January 23, 2023
  • Bitcoin price consolidation opens the door for APE, MANA, AAVE and FIL to move higher January 22, 2023
  • Genesis bankruptcy case scheduled for first hearing January 22, 2023
  • Terra lending protocol Mars to launch mainnet January 22, 2023
  • Central African Republic eyes legal framework for crypto adoption January 22, 2023

News Categories

  • Bitcoin
  • Blockchain
  • Business
  • Market

Tags

bitcoinMagzine Cointelegraph Cryptocurrency insidebitcoins Investment Mining Bitcoin NewsBTC

Quicklinks

  • Home
  • Coins MarketCap
  • Crypto Exchanges
  • Crypto Calculator
  • Top Gainers and Loser
  • News
  • Contact Us

© 2022 Xbt.Market - Powered by YYC Tech Consulting & ADMCO.

No Result
View All Result
  • Home
  • Coins MarketCap
  • Crypto Exchanges
  • Crypto Calculator
  • Top Gainers and Loser
  • News
  • Contact Us

© 2022 Xbt.Market by Nebulome.

  • bitcoinBitcoin(BTC)$23,340.000.77%
  • ethereumEthereum(ETH)$1,609.050.51%
  • USDEXUSDEX(USDEX)$1.07-0.53%
  • tetherTether(USDT)$1.00-0.12%
  • usd-coinUSD Coin(USDC)$1.00-0.32%
  • binancecoinBNB(BNB)$308.970.11%
  • rippleXRP(XRP)$0.414184-0.07%
  • Binance USDBinance USD(BUSD)$1.00-0.41%
  • cardanoCardano(ADA)$0.389335-1.33%
  • dogecoinDogecoin(DOGE)$0.0893821.20%
  • matic-networkPolygon(MATIC)$1.15-0.14%
  • OKBOKB(OKB)$39.438.50%
  • SolanaSolana(SOL)$24.39-1.27%
  • Lido Staked EtherLido Staked Ether(STETH)$1,605.720.47%
  • polkadotPolkadot(DOT)$6.50-1.52%
  • Shiba InuShiba Inu(SHIB)$0.0000121.17%
  • litecoinLitecoin(LTC)$96.068.20%
  • AvalancheAvalanche(AVAX)$20.65-1.30%
  • tronTRON(TRX)$0.063545-0.03%
  • UniswapUniswap(UNI)$6.80-0.99%
  • daiDai(DAI)$1.00-0.14%
  • wrapped-bitcoinWrapped Bitcoin(WBTC)$23,289.000.65%
  • cosmosCosmos Hub(ATOM)$13.33-2.89%
  • ToncoinToncoin(TON)$2.51-2.17%
  • leo-tokenLEO Token(LEO)$3.94-1.28%
  • chainlinkChainlink(LINK)$7.40-1.27%
  • moneroMonero(XMR)$183.961.62%
  • ethereum-classicEthereum Classic(ETC)$22.642.53%
  • AptosAptos(APT)$18.01-3.78%
  • bitcoin-cashBitcoin Cash(BCH)$135.580.66%
  • Aerarium FiAerarium Fi(AERA)$7.14-13.09%
  • stellarStellar(XLM)$0.093408-0.42%
  • ApeCoinApeCoin(APE)$6.09-3.91%
  • QuantQuant(QNT)$151.12-0.92%
  • NEAR ProtocolNEAR Protocol(NEAR)$2.51-2.78%
  • CronosCronos(CRO)$0.082086-0.35%
  • filecoinFilecoin(FIL)$5.39-1.52%
  • Lido DAOLido DAO(LDO)$2.29-6.12%
  • algorandAlgorand(ALGO)$0.259179-2.14%
  • vechainVeChain(VET)$0.024494-1.60%
  • Internet ComputerInternet Computer(ICP)$6.100.86%
  • HederaHedera(HBAR)$0.068132-2.73%
  • Axie InfinityAxie Infinity(AXS)$11.54-2.74%
  • decentralandDecentraland(MANA)$0.70-1.64%
  • AaveAave(AAVE)$85.95-2.23%
  • eosEOS(EOS)$1.11-0.85%
  • The SandboxThe Sandbox(SAND)$0.75-3.35%
  • FantomFantom(FTM)$0.455321-4.30%
  • FlowFlow(FLOW)$1.08-3.03%
  • MultiversXMultiversX(EGLD)$44.69-1.23%
  • theta-tokenTheta Network(THETA)$1.09-1.58%
  • Terra Luna ClassicTerra Luna Classic(LUNC)$0.0001740.39%
  • tezosTezos(XTZ)$1.11-2.04%
  • FraxFrax(FRAX)$1.00-0.50%
  • true-usdTrueUSD(TUSD)$1.010.22%
  • paxos-standardPax Dollar(USDP)$1.00-0.65%
  • bitcoin-cash-svBitcoin SV(BSV)$44.10-0.37%
  • huobi-tokenHuobi(HT)$5.161.70%
  • The GraphThe Graph(GRT)$0.093936-2.34%
  • Frax ShareFrax Share(FXS)$11.07-1.31%
  • kucoin-sharesKuCoin(KCS)$8.183.49%
  • Curve DAOCurve DAO(CRV)$1.09-2.95%
  • havvenSynthetix Network(SNX)$2.49-1.93%
  • Rocket PoolRocket Pool(RPL)$39.27-0.57%
  • ChilizChiliz(CHZ)$0.138910-1.03%
  • eCasheCash(XEC)$0.000038-2.26%
  • Trust WalletTrust Wallet(TWT)$1.74-0.84%
  • USDDUSDD(USDD)$0.99-0.19%
  • BitTorrentBitTorrent(BTT)$0.000001-0.26%
  • PancakeSwapPancakeSwap(CAKE)$4.02-0.13%
  • KlaytnKlaytn(KLAY)$0.217816-1.10%
  • BitDAOBitDAO(BIT)$0.57-1.81%
  • iotaIOTA(MIOTA)$0.239192-2.09%
  • dashDash(DASH)$56.589.29%
  • GateGate(GT)$4.221.04%
  • zcashZcash(ZEC)$46.67-0.14%
  • makerMaker(MKR)$663.19-3.05%
  • neoNEO(NEO)$8.37-0.37%
  • cUSDCcUSDC(CUSDC)$0.0227460.16%
  • gemini-dollarGemini Dollar(GUSD)$1.00-0.34%
  • OKCOKC(OKT)$31.805.05%
  • THORChainTHORChain(RUNE)$1.86-1.42%
  • cDAIcDAI(CDAI)$0.022146-0.01%
  • BTSE TokenBTSE Token(BTSE)$3.39-1.58%
  • Tokenize XchangeTokenize Xchange(TKX)$6.752.61%
  • Mina ProtocolMina Protocol(MINA)$0.65-2.07%
  • ImmutableXImmutableX(IMX)$0.66-3.77%
  • WhiteBIT TokenWhiteBIT Token(WBT)$4.10-0.39%
  • RadixRadix(XRD)$0.05193015.28%
  • ArweaveArweave(AR)$10.30-1.15%
  • PAX GoldPAX Gold(PAXG)$1,921.51-0.34%
  • OsmosisOsmosis(OSMO)$0.98-2.46%
  • GMXGMX(GMX)$56.853.24%
  • zilliqaZilliqa(ZIL)$0.029543-3.07%
  • OptimismOptimism(OP)$2.22-5.53%
  • FlareFlare(FLR)$0.0433339.28%
  • nexoNEXO(NEXO)$0.85-0.48%
  • Tether GoldTether Gold(XAUT)$1,890.570.21%
  • cETHcETH(CETH)$31.91-0.93%
  • enjincoinEnjin Coin(ENJ)$0.454581-7.52%